The most common digestive symptoms include: Nausea (very common, affecting more than 1 in 10 people) Diarrhoea (very common, affecting more than 1 in 10 people) Decreased appetite (very common, a desired therapeutic effect but can be uncomfortable) Vomiting (common, affecting up to 1 in 10 people) Constipation (common, affecting up to 1 in 10 people) Abdominal pain or discomfort (common) Dyspepsia (indigestion) Flatulence and bloating Regarding stool colour changes , including green stools, there is no official direct link established in the clinical trial data or product literature for Mounjaro
